Clerk Webhooks & Events
Overview
Configure and handle Clerk webhooks for user lifecycle events and data synchronization. Clerk uses Svix for webhook delivery with HMAC-SHA256 signature verification. As of 2025, Clerk provides a built-in verifyWebhook() helper in @clerk/backend alongside the manual Svix approach.

Instructions
Step 1: Install Dependencies
# Option A: Use @clerk/backend's built-in verifyWebhook() (recommended)
# Already included with @clerk/nextjs — no extra install needed
# Option B: Manual Svix verification
npm install svix
Step 2: Create Webhook Endpoint (verifyWebhook — Recommended)
// app/api/webhooks/clerk/route.ts
import { verifyWebhook } from '@clerk/backend/webhooks'
import type { WebhookEvent } from '@clerk/nextjs/server'
export async function POST(req: Request) {
let evt: WebhookEvent
try {
evt = await verifyWebhook(req)
} catch (err) {
console.error('Webhook verification failed:', err)
return new Response('Invalid signature', { status: 400 })
}
return handleWebhookEvent(evt)
}
Step 2 (Alternative): Manual Svix Verification
// app/api/webhooks/clerk/route.ts
import { Webhook } from 'svix'
import { headers } from 'next/headers'
import type { WebhookEvent } from '@clerk/nextjs/server'
export async function POST(req: Request) {
const WEBHOOK_SECRET = process.env.CLERK_WEBHOOK_SECRET
if (!WEBHOOK_SECRET) {
throw new Error('Missing CLERK_WEBHOOK_SECRET env variable')
}
const headerPayload = await headers()
const svixHeaders = {
'svix-id': headerPayload.get('svix-id') || '',
'svix-timestamp': headerPayload.get('svix-timestamp') || '',
'svix-signature': headerPayload.get('svix-signature') || '',
}
if (!svixHeaders['svix-id'] || !svixHeaders['svix-signature']) {
return new Response('Missing svix headers', { status: 400 })
}
// CRITICAL: Use req.text(), NOT req.json() — JSON parsing alters the payload
// and breaks signature verification
const body = await req.text()
const wh = new Webhook(WEBHOOK_SECRET)
let evt: WebhookEvent
try {
evt = wh.verify(body, svixHeaders) as WebhookEvent
} catch (err) {
console.error('Webhook verification failed:', err)
return new Response('Invalid signature', { status: 400 })
}
return handleWebhookEvent(evt)
}

Step 4: Idempotency Protection
// lib/webhook-idempotency.ts
// Clerk/Svix may retry failed deliveries — prevent duplicate processing
export async function processIdempotently(
svixId: string,
eventType: string,
handler: () => Promise<void>
): Promise<{ processed: boolean; duplicate: boolean }> {
// Check if already processed (use your DB or Redis)
const existing = await db.webhookEvent.findUnique({
where: { svixId },
})
if (existing) {
console.log(`[Webhook] Duplicate event skipped: ${svixId} (${eventType})`)
return { processed: false, duplicate: true }
}
// Mark as processing (before handler, to catch concurrent deliveries)
await db.webhookEvent.create({
data: { svixId, eventType, status: 'processing', receivedAt: new Date() },
})
try {
await handler()
await db.webhookEvent.update({
where: { svixId },
data: { status: 'completed', processedAt: new Date() },
})
return { processed: true, duplicate: false }
} catch (error) {
await db.webhookEvent.update({
where: { svixId },
data: { status: 'failed', error: String(error) },
})
throw error
}
}

Step 6: Express.js Webhook Endpoint
import express from 'express'
import { Webhook } from 'svix'
const app = express()
// CRITICAL: Use express.raw(), NOT express.json() for webhook routes
app.post('/api/webhooks/clerk',
express.raw({ type: 'application/json' }),
(req, res) => {
const wh = new Webhook(process.env.CLERK_WEBHOOK_SECRET!)
try {
const evt = wh.verify(req.body, {
'svix-id': req.headers['svix-id'] as string,
'svix-timestamp': req.headers['svix-timestamp'] as string,
'svix-signature': req.headers['svix-signature'] as string,
})
// Handle event...
res.status(200).json({ received: true })
} catch (err) {
console.error('Webhook verification failed:', err)
res.status(400).json({ error: 'Invalid signature' })
}
}
)

Error Handling
| Error | Cause | Solution |
|---|---|---|
| Invalid signature | Wrong CLERKWEBHOOKSECRET |
Re-copy signing secret from Dashboard > Webhooks |
| Invalid signature | Body parsed with json() before verify |
Use req.text() (Next.js) or express.raw() (Express) |
| Missing svix headers | Request not from Clerk/Svix | Verify endpoint URL; check sender |
| Duplicate processing | Clerk retried delivery | Implement idempotency with svix-id as unique key |
| Handler timeout | Slow DB operations | Offload heavy work to a background job queue |
| 404 on webhook URL | Route not matching | Ensure /api/webhooks is in middleware's isPublicRoute |
Enterprise Considerations
- Treat
CLERKWEBHOOKSECRETlike a password -- rotate it if compromised (Dashboard > Webhooks > Signing Secret > Rotate) - Svix headers include
svix-timestampfor replay attack protection (rejects events older than 5 minutes by default) - For high-volume apps, offload webhook processing to a queue (BullMQ, Inngest, Trigger.dev) and return 200 immediately
- Monitor webhook delivery in Dashboard > Webhooks > Message Logs -- failed messages auto-retry with exponential backoff
- Use
verifyWebhook()from@clerk/backend/webhookswhen possible -- it handles header extraction and secret key resolution automatically
